**Catalogue Import — Batch Sizing**

The Fennwick Library Consortium feed arrives nightly as MARC-style records, roughly 400k rows. Importer (codename Shelfwright) validates, dedupes against the Brindle catalogue, then upserts in batches. Oversized batches lock the holdings table; undersized ones blow out runtime past the 4 a.m. cutoff. Don't change batch logic without checking the dedupe cache, which is sized to match. Current tuning constants are listed below.

tuning table, kajog-kawef:
PRIORITIES = {
    "kelox": 870,
    "kasix": 89,
    "eliax": 988,
}

## Support

Filtra is the bloom filter layer sitting in front of the Cordwell key-value store. For the security review: false-positive rates are logged but never the queried keys themselves, and the filter state file is encrypted at rest. If you find any path where key material could leak into diagnostics, report it privately at the address below.

escalation mailbox, yafog-kafof: eliok@xolmarcloud.local

## Step 7 — Enable Log Sampling for Chattervane

Set the sampling rate to 1:50 for info-level logs before promoting; Chattervane emits roughly 9k lines per second at peak. Reviewer should confirm error logs remain unsampled. Once config is approved, sign the deploy manifest with the key below.

release key, yahof-yawep: bky9_PPPumbRVg

**Leadership Review Briefing — Tessaro Rewards Overhaul**

Prepared for sales leads. The Tessaro Rewards overhaul replaces points-based accrual with tiered spend bands, simplifying redemption and cutting administrative load at branch level. Early modelling suggests improved retention among mid-tier members, though breakage revenue declines modestly. Migration of existing balances completes next quarter, with staff training scheduled beforehand. Please review the confidential planning note below before briefing your teams.

board note of bawep-tajef: Queniusek Systems plans to raise the Quenvan list price by 53.1 percent in March. The pricing group signed off on a budget of $176.4 million for Project Drueth. The renewal with Casionix Partners closes at $142.5 million a year, 8.3 percent below the last contract. Project Fraax slips by six weeks because of the tooling delay.